An
Introduction to Microsoft Excel XP (476kb, 41
pages)
A
hands-on beginner’s training tutorial for working with
spreadsheets using Excel. Features covered include: the Excel
screen, Task panes, Cell references, entering and editing data into
cells, ranges, column widths, formatting cells, working with sheets,
borders, spell checking, entering and copying formulas, and creating
and working with charts.
